<h4 style="text-align: center;"><em>Canadian workers not prepared to deal with financial impact of disabilities</em></h4>
<p><strong>More than half of Canadians believe they would experience financial difficulty if their pay was delayed by even one week</strong></p>
<p>Yet, mental illness, cancer, cardiovascular diseases and musculoskeletal diseases such as arthritis cause more disabilities than accidents.  In fact, these diseases are 6 times more likely to be the cause of a disability.</p>
<p>Most Canadian workers would suffer severe financial hardship if they were forced out of work with a disability, according to a recent RBC Insurance survey. Three-in-four (76 per cent) believe that should they become disabled and unable to work for three months there would be serious financial implications for their family, such as significant debt or an impact on retirement plans.</p>
<p>Despite the concern, only about a quarter (27 per cent) of Canadian workers has discussed how a disability would financially impact their family. This number does not even increase substantially among workers who’ve indicated that they’ve taken time off in the past because of a partial disability (33 per cent).</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h1 style="text-align: center;">Travelling out of Province or  Country?</h1>
<h2>Travel Insurance may be the last thing on your mind when planning on jet-setting to exotic locations across the globe or out of province but forgetting or ignoring proper Travel Insurance coverages could cost you thousands of dollars.</h2>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><a href="https://www.cuttherisk.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/08/are-you-Travelling-out-of-province-or-country1.jpg"><img decoding="async" loading="lazy" class="size-medium wp-image-528 alignleft" src="https://www.cuttherisk.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/08/are-you-Travelling-out-of-province-or-country1-300x200.jpg" alt="are you Travelling out of province or country" width="300" height="200" srcset="https://www.cuttherisk.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/08/are-you-Travelling-out-of-province-or-country1-300x200.jpg 300w, https://www.cuttherisk.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/08/are-you-Travelling-out-of-province-or-country1-280x186.jpg 280w, https://www.cuttherisk.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/08/are-you-Travelling-out-of-province-or-country1.jpg 640w" sizes="(max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px" /></a></p>
<p>Get your Travel Insurance when planning your trip making sure that you can pass all medical questions before leaving home! If you travel frequently throughout the year, purchase an annual Travel Insurance Policy to cover your travel in Canada and foreign countries.</p>
<p>Know what Travel Insurance you are buying to avoid a vacation disaster.  Make sure you are covered for the type of activities you plan to do while out of country. Note that the “Standard Travel Insurance” may not cover you for diving or mountain climbing. You must be aware that if you have a special need or if you are going to a different kind of destination or participating in different activities, you must make sure that the Travel Insurance product that you purchase will actually cover your needs.</p>
<p>The Travel Insurance Industry is one of the highest paying claims groups within the Insurance Industry.  Denied claims represent 2 to 3percent of active policies.</p>

<p>Not all Provincial Health Coverages for travel are the same.  Recently, a lady visiting Ontario from Alberta had a premature baby.  She is faced with an air ambulance bill of $30,000 because the Province of Alberta does not cover this situation.  An Ontario resident would have this service covered.</p>
